Transcribed Image Text:### Critical Thinking: Outliers
One indicator of an outlier is that an observation is more than 2.5 standard deviations from the mean. Consider the data value 80.
(a) If a data set has mean 70 and standard deviation 5, is 80 a suspect outlier?
(b) If a data set has mean 70 and standard deviation 3, is 80 a suspect outlier?
### Basic Computation: Variance, Standard Deviation
Given the sample data \(x\):
\[ 23 \quad 17 \quad 15 \quad 30 \quad 25 \]
(a) Find the range.
(b) Verify that \(\sum x = 110\) and \(\sum x^2 = 2568\).
(c) Use the results of part (b) and appropriate computation formulas to compute the sample variance \(s^2\) and sample standard deviation \(s\).
(d) Use the defining formulas to compute the sample variance \(s^2\) and sample standard deviation \(s\).
(e) Suppose the given data comprise the entire population of all \(x\) values. Compute the population variance \(\sigma^2\) and population standard deviation \(\sigma\).
